These fascinating paintings show what the world looks like for short-sighted people

In a world which increasingly values the work of hyper-realist painters, the creative output of Philip Barlow draws your attention immediately. But it takes a special effort to study his work, which forces you to look at a world of blurred silhouettes and bright, indistinct spots. In applying this style, Barlow shows us vividly what the world looks like for many people who have poor eyesight.
Here are a few of Barlow’s striking paintings for you to consider. For those of us who don’t have to wear glasses or contact lenses, they left a real long-lasting impression on us. It’s incredible to think that the world can seem so different depending on your perspective.
